The Invisible Load: Oils, Salts, and the Microbiome

Every time we sit on a fabric chair or sofa, a transfer of material occurs. Human skin naturally secretes sebum (oils) and perspiration, which contains salts, enzymes, and fatty acids. These substances are absorbed by the fabric fibers and, over time, migrate into the polyurethane foam or down padding beneath. This “metabolite load” creates a unique microbiome within the furniture.

When skin oils are allowed to accumulate, they undergo a chemical process called oxidation. This is why the headrests and armrests of well-used furniture often develop a darkened, slightly tacky texture. In leather upholstery, these oils can actually rot the protein structure of the hide, leading to irreversible cracking and peeling. In synthetic or natural textiles, the oils act as an adhesive, causing airborne dust and soot to stick to the fibers. This creates a “graying” effect that cannot be removed by simple vacuuming, as the dirt is chemically bonded to the oily residue.

Why Surface Cleaning Often Fails

A common mistake in home maintenance is the reliance on retail “spot cleaners” or heavy scrubbing. When a spill occurs, the instinct is to apply a cleaning solution and rub vigorously. However, this often causes two distinct types of damage. First, the mechanical action of scrubbing can fray the delicate “nap” or pile of the fabric, leading to permanent pilling or a fuzzy appearance. Second, without a high-powered extraction system, the moisture and dissolved dirt are simply pushed deeper into the cushion.

Furthermore, many consumer-grade cleaning agents are high in surfactants, soaps that are designed to be “sticky” to grab dirt. If these soaps are not fully rinsed out using professional-grade equipment, they stay in the fabric. Once dry, these residues continue to do their job, attracting new dust and dander from the air. This explains the common phenomenon where a sofa appears to get dirty again just weeks after a DIY cleaning. The “Filter” Effect and Indoor Air Quality

It is helpful to think of upholstered furniture as a massive, secondary air filter. The textured surface of woven fabric is exceptionally good at catching fine particulates like pollen, pet dander, and mold spores that circulate through the HVAC system. While this keeps these irritants out of the air temporarily, the filter eventually becomes “full.”

When a person sits down on a saturated sofa, the compression of the cushions acts like a bellows, forcing a concentrated cloud of these trapped allergens back into the breathing zone. For individuals with respiratory sensitivities or asthma, this can be a primary trigger for symptoms. Deep-tissue cleaning through thermal extraction, using controlled heat and steam, does more than just remove stains; it sanitizes the interior of the furniture, killing dust mites and neutralizing the biological proteins that cause odors.

Navigating Material Diversity: From Velvet to Linen

The challenge of modern upholstery is the sheer variety of materials used. A cleaning method that works perfectly on a durable polyester-blend sectional could be catastrophic for an acetate velvet armchair or a delicate linen chaise lounge.

  • Natural Fibers: Linen, cotton, and wool are highly absorbent. They are prone to “water ringing” if over-saturated and can shrink if the water temperature is not precisely controlled.
  • Synthetic Fibers: Polyester, nylon, and acrylic are generally more resilient to water-based cleaning but can be sensitive to high heat, which can “melt” or distort the synthetic pile.
  • Specialty Fabrics: Suede and certain types of velvet require specialized “dry” cleaning solvents or very low-moisture foam to prevent the pile from collapsing or becoming stiff.

Because most furniture does not come with a detailed “laundry tag” similar to clothing, identifying the fiber content is the first step in any restoration project. Professionals are trained to perform “burn tests” or chemical reactions on inconspicuous areas to determine exactly how a fabric will react to moisture and heat.

The Economics of Maintenance

From a financial perspective, the cost of regular upholstery care is a fraction of the cost of replacement. High-quality furniture is an investment intended to last a decade or more, but the “useful life” of a piece is often cut short by neglect. When grit is allowed to stay in the fibers, it acts like sandpaper, grinding away at the yarns every time someone sits down. This leads to “thinning” of the fabric and eventual holes.

By scheduling a deep clean every 12 to 18 months, homeowners can remove this abrasive grit and the acidic oils that break down fiber integrity. This proactive approach preserves the original “hand” or feel of the fabric and keeps the colors vibrant, preventing the dull, washed-out look that characterizes aged furniture.
